Which payroll item represents compensation paid after separation from service?

Explanation:
Final pay is the last paycheck issued when a service member leaves or retires, settling earnings up to the date of separation and any terminal pay required by policy. It represents compensation paid after separation from service. SGLI is life insurance coverage, not pay. Meal deductions are amounts taken out for meals, reducing take-home pay but not pay itself. Leave balance is the record of unused leave and, while it may be cashed out in some cases, the category itself isn’t the compensation paid after separation. So the correct choice is final pay.
